London, UK – February, 24, 2026 – eXate, a pioneer in data privacy, protection, and dynamic access control solutions, and Aqua Global, a long-established provider of financial messaging and transaction automation solutions, today announced a strategic partnership. This collaboration marks a significant step forward in enabling financial institutions to securely process, govern, and protect sensitive transaction data while meeting evolving regulatory requirements.
Aqua Global brings over 43 years of experience delivering financial messaging and transaction automation solutions for payments, treasury, and securities processing, integrating internal banking systems with external services through its high-performance Aquila orchestration and integration framework. Complementing this, eXate provides distributed data privacy and protection technology that embeds centralised, policy-driven controls directly into data ingestion and distribution points, enabling dynamic data masking, redaction, and Attribute-Based Access Control (ABAC) across complex financial ecosystems.
This agreement comes at a time when banks face increasing pressure from global regulations, regional data protection laws, and emerging AI governance frameworks. As transaction volumes grow and ecosystems become more interconnected, financial institutions require privacy-by-design solutions that protect sensitive data across borders and jurisdictions.
Together, Aqua Global and eXate will help financial institutions simplify complexity, strengthen compliance, reduce operational risk, and accelerate transformation, without compromising performance, scalability, or control.
